CME Group and data provider Silicon Data are partnering to introduce a new “compute futures market” that will allow traders to hedge or speculate on the price of AI semiconductors. The contracts, based on GPU price indexes, are expected to provide a novel financial instrument tied to the booming AI infrastructure sector.

CME Group (NYSE: CME) and technology data firm Silicon Data have announced a partnership to launch a new futures market focused on artificial intelligence semiconductors. According to a joint statement released last week, the proposed “compute futures market” will track underlying GPU price indexes, giving futures traders the ability to lock in the cost of computing capacity. The initiative responds to the massive capital flows into GPUs and AI data centers, which have grown rapidly amid surging demand for AI training and inference hardware. The contracts are designed to serve both as a hedging tool for companies exposed to GPU price volatility and as a speculative instrument for traders seeking exposure to the AI chip sector. The announcement was made public on May 24, 2026, and marks the first time that AI semiconductor pricing will be directly traded as a futures contract on a major exchange. CME Group is the world’s largest derivatives marketplace, while Silicon Data specializes in providing hardware pricing and benchmark data for the computing industry.

The new market could offer a way for hyperscale cloud providers, GPU resellers, and semiconductor manufacturers to manage cost uncertainty. By referencing a GPU benchmark, the futures contracts would allow participants to secure future computing capacity at a known price, potentially reducing the financial risk associated with rapid price swings in AI hardware. For speculative traders, the contracts may provide a pure-play avenue to bet on the direction of AI chip prices without directly buying or selling physical GPUs. Analysts suggest that if liquidity develops, the market could become an additional barometer for sentiment in the AI ecosystem, alongside existing equity and semiconductor indices. The launch timing aligns with continued heavy investment in AI infrastructure by major technology companies. The contracts could also attract interest from energy firms and data center operators whose operational costs are tied to GPU availability and pricing.

While the futures market is not yet live, its introduction may signal a maturing of the AI hardware ecosystem into a more financially structured asset class. The ability to hedge GPU price risk could make large-scale AI project financing more viable, potentially accelerating deployment of new data centers and processing capacity. However, the success of such contracts will depend on market adoption, underlying benchmark reliability, and the ability to attract sufficient trading volume. The compute futures market would likely face challenges common to new derivative products, including initial liquidity constraints and the need for standardized pricing methodologies. Investors and market participants should monitor the rollout and assess how the contracts correlate with other semiconductor and technology indices. As with any new financial instrument, outcomes remain uncertain and subject to evolving market conditions.
